Join us for the inaugural Regen Film Festival happening during RegenerativeNYC 2025! celebrating films that explore regenerative practices and sustainable food systems. Sponsored by Why Regenerative and WonderMapper, this festival brings conversations about regeneration into urban spaces through cinema. The festival takes place as a showcase as part of Regenerative NYC 2025. Regenerative NYC 2024 was a sold out hit and we're excited to introduce Regen Film for 2025!

We showcase films highlighting how regenerative approaches restore biodiversity, sequester carbon, and create resilient ecosystems. Filmmakers exploring regenerative agriculture, environmental stewardship, and community building are invited to submit their work!

Set in New York City, this festival creates a unique platform connecting farmers, investors, policymakers, consumers, and filmmakers. Through screenings taking place adjacent to the RegenerativeNYC 25' event discussions, and networking events, we amplify voices of leaders in regenerative practices and foster collaborations to transform our relationship with food and land.

Regenerative in Film and NYC Festival and Showcase - Rules and Terms

ELIGIBILITY
- Films must be documentary shorts with a running time of 35 minutes or less.
- Films must have been completed within the last 3 years.
- Films must address themes related to regenerative practices, environmental stewardship, sustainable food systems, or related outdoor/environmental topics.
- Films may be submitted by filmmakers of any nationality, but must include English subtitles if not in English.
- Submitted works must be the original creation of the applicant.
- Projects must be shot with real-life documentary subjects and cannot be AI creations.

SUBMISSION REQUIREMENTS
- Complete submission form via Film Freeway with all required information.
- Films must be uploaded in high-quality digital format as specified on Film Freeway.
- Each submission must include a synopsis, director's statement, and at least three high-resolution stills from the film.
- Filmmakers must hold all necessary rights for public exhibition of their work.

T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S
- Final screening copies must be provided by April 20th.
- Format requirements: 16:9 23.976 HD and 4K (if available) ProRes 422 LQ.
- Projects shot in 2.35, 2.39, or 9:16 must be matted to 16:9.
